Flood damage to an Elk Lick Township bridge is closing a busy two-lane section of U.S. Route 219 to traffic indefinitely, state officials said.
PennDOT Secretary Mike Carroll visited Somerset County May 16 to view the flood-damaged U.S. Route 219 (Mason-Dixon Highway) bridge over Piney Creek in the village of Boynton.
